Dandy Cooling Company is responsible for the West Coast Shipping operations for Duda Farm Fresh Foods. We own and operate facilities in Salinas, Oxnard, & Yuma. We also manage the shipping operations in Huron, at Dresick Cooling, during the spring and fall seasons.

Our Salinas and Oxnard facilities run during California’s summer growing season. Here we cool and ship a variety of produce items, from lettuce and leafy greens, to celery, broccoli, and cauliflower. During California’s winter months, our Oxnard facility is open and we operate our Yuma facility for Arizona’s growing season.

Responsibilities & Duties: 

Compliance, Policy, Administration and Documentation

  • Evaluate hazards within the facility for safety, health, and environmental risks.
  • Develop health and safety procedures and programs for all departments and monitor safety compliance to reduce risks.
  • Maintain contingency plans, including fire prevention and procedures for controlling hazardous spills in accordance with government regulations and insurance company requirements.
  • Supervise maintenance of material safety data sheets so they are accessible at all times according to state and federal regulations.
  • Develop inspection policies and establish regular inspection schedules.
  • Maintain EPA records of hazardous waste, air emission permitted and water pollution discharge, as well as industrial health monitoring and records of employee hazard exposure according to OSHA regulations.
  • Develop, maintain and update Dandy Cooling policies for safety standards, emergency preparedness, IIPP, safety training etc.

Safety Program Training

  • Identify, as qualified, legal requirements and governmental reporting regulations affecting the safety and quality assurance functions (e.g., Federal, State, OSHA, etc).
  • Supervise training sessions for emergency preparedness, confined spaces, electrical safety, machine guarding, fall protection and forklift safety.
  • Experience in developing, creating and presenting new safety programs using compliant information and PowerPoint.
  • Ability to communicate to large or small groups in English and Spanish to ensure the transfer of knowledge and compliance with Dandy Cooling Safety Training policies as well as federal and state regulations.
